Re: FFR Standalone!
Logging in via the game should work for each version now for recording scores; it's more saving replays that has the issue of not being able to save (at least for the legacy engine). Perhaps it's something we can revisit but at this time I don't know a workaround really unless you can download IE on a Chromebook (perhaps https://chrome.google.com/webstore/d...kndeccohnpcoce just to log in, then leave it? I don't know if that app caches the data the way the standalone expects it to be stored though, so I can't testify to it... or test it for that matter. If you do test it, let me know).
